Output d63f65263c588040dbc03b1983559a4f2ceda6e488558f03abd71b092f56184d:93

value
8104
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4c5d485a8ece52bb79e3de62ba4ee30dc5417df9525f568b8dda311c9f14d4ab
address
bc1pf3w5sk5weeftk70rme3t5nhrphz5zl0e2f04dzudmgc3e8c56j4srae589
transaction
d63f65263c588040dbc03b1983559a4f2ceda6e488558f03abd71b092f56184d
confirmations
131939
spent
true